Prayers for Mexico
Mexico appears in these prayers through earthquakes, landslides and storms, and through violence, disappearances and the search for missing people. Migration is a constant theme, with families crossing and waiting at the northern border. Elections, water and the arts are held here too, with thanks for ordinary kindness along the way.
